First room smelled like cigarette smoke so I requested another one. Second room was ok (3rd floor). Could not hear trafiic noise although hotel is very close to 55 hwy. Whole hotel would need renovation. Both rooms felt kind of damp. Service was good. Breakfast was included but very basic. For $100 ok hotel, but fairly basic and old. more

Some will be disappointed here if they are looking for paradise. But for an area of over-priced hotels, this place is a huge bargain. It's a tad beat-up but pretty clean, free wireless, good location. Moderate your expectations and you'll feel good about the deal. Jack-in-the Box a couple doors down....go get your tacos, do e-mail, go to bed. more
